Although his gravestone shows Maurice was born circa 1872 the P.E.I. PARO Baptismal Registry recorded Maurice Butler was born on July 10, 1870 to Mary (née O'Halloran) and James Butler and was baptized by cleric J. A. MacDonald on September 3, 1871 in the St. Mark's Roman Catholic Church at Burton, P.E.I. In 1881 Maurice was living on his parents' farm in Lot 7 of Prince County. The family enumerated at the 1881 census were James and Mary and nine of their children - Mary Ann (17), Catherine (15), Lawrence (12), Ellen (11), Maurice (9), Agnes (7), Margaret "Maggie" (5), James (3) and Johannah "Hannah" (1). Two more children were born after 1881 - Joseph Peter (b: May 8, 1883) and Elizabeth (b: March 2, 1886). ~Maurice Butler married Annie Loretta Griffin at Glengarry and two sons and four daughters were born from the union [Albert Edward (b:9-25-1902), Myrtle Mary (b:8-1-1905), Alma Ann (b:12-28-1907), Margaret Ida [Sister Saint Mauritius of Saint Mary's Convent in Summerside] (b:7-5-1912), Bernice Elizabeth (b:1-21-1916) and Charles Vernon (b:12-16-1919)].
